Summary
Oil painting on canvas, Called Edward Chute (d.1722), but really Anthony Chute (1691-1754) by British (English) School, c.1720.Three-quarter-length portrait, to right, right hand on hip, left resting on a table, wearing a brick-coloured coat and waistcoat and white stock; landscape, right.
Provenance
Bequeathed with The Vyne, estate and contents by Sir Charles Chute, 1st Bt (1879-1956)
